an interesting spec sheet comparison.
-25hp more, 15ft-lb of torque more than 991, same as gt3 just slightly higher in the range at 6250rpm
-fixed valve train, 2 intake tuning flaps, and central oiling which we know about already
-slightly different rear diff settings vs the R.
-991.2 is quite a bit heavier, about 120lb more, (90lb more with the manual)
-hp/lb is actually down
-steel rotors are now same size as pccb (not sure if this is a good thing or not.. did it need heavier bigger brakes?)
-same height as before.. hasn't been lowered, but 0.2 inch less ground clearance measured at rear diffusor
-but... front angle of approached has improved quite a bit from 5.8 to 6.3in as well as breakover has improved slightly (new "do I need a front lift" thread coming up)
-rear suspension has a little helper spring
